THE JEWELLERY SUITES, SHORT TERM LETS BIRMINGHAM- THE RUBY AND SAPPHIRE SUITES, JEWELLERY SUITES. We have 2 3 bedroom apartments situated just off the beautiful St Paul’s Square. They both sleep up to 8 and are located in the same building one above the other ideal for large groups wanting a getaway together. You can rent one of them or both, depending on your needs. The suite boasts a spacious master bedroom with king size bed, 40” wall-mounted television with Sky. The second double bedroom comes with cupboards; the third, has another double bed. The Ruby Suite has an en-suite shower room. Lounge facilities include a leather corner suite that can convert into a further double bed, genuine oak furniture, a 42” wall-mounted television with Sky and a dining table. The fully functional kitchen includes breakfast bar, coffee machine and washer dryer. All crockery, glassware and utensils are provided. When you arrive, you will find your cupboards stocked with the basic essentials – tea, coffee, milk, sugar, etc. The luxury marbled bathroom has both shower and full-sized bath. All towels and linen are provided. The suites come with free wi-fi connection, sky TV and desk space with printer in the master bedroom.
